Travis is the best prospect to come along in the Jays system since Carlos Delgado, and while it is definitely "out on a linb" to say what i'm going to say (I'm going to say it anyways)...

He just might end up better than Carlos Delgado.

Will that be next year? Good question. Paul Godfrey was quoted in August as saying that the team will need to add two things this winter: a pitcher if AJ leaves, and a big bat at DH.

Of course, Godfrey is gone now. It looks possible that AJ might re-sign, and that alleviates some of the pressure to spend the 25 million or so that the team has this winter to sign pitching. But Marcum is done for 2009, and if AJ leaves, I would pretty much pencil in Snider as the Jays DH next year because this team is too close not to be forced to go after at least a guy like Derek Lowe or Ryan Dempster...and that will pretty much break their bank.

If Snider indeed ends up the full time DH next year, I like his chances of putting up ROY numbers. You'd have to figure he would bat somewhere around 6th and 7th. My prediction? .278 AVG, 70R, 31 Doubles, 22HR, 90 RBI, .310 OBP
